Figure 5.
BEAF-32 is active at the transcriptional response at 29°C. (A) Heatmap of differentially expressed genes between 18 and 29°C at wild-type or beaf32−/− samples, or between wild-type and beaf32−/− samples at 18 or 29°C. A gene was included in the heatmap if it had an adjusted P-value < 0.1 and log2 fold change >0.75 in at least one of the pairwise comparison. (B) The motif enriched in genes upregulated at 29°C in wild-type flies versus 18°C wild-type (left), compared with the enriched motif in genes upregulated at 29°C wild-type versus 29°C beaf32−/− flies (middle) and the enriched motif in genes upregulated at 29°C beaf32−/− flies versus beaf32−/− at 18°C (right). (C) Log2 Fold Change at 18 and 29°C between the wild-type and beaf32−/− samples of the genes upregulated at 29°C wild-type versus 29°C beaf32−/− and harbor the BEAF-32 binding motif at their promoter. Arrow represents the location of most of those genes on the heatmap. Asterisk represents P-value < 0.05 between the distributions of the fold change using a t-test. Error bar represents the standard deviation.
